Sustainable Opportunity Development Center (EIN: 90-0630610) has filed an IRS Form 990 since at least fiscal year 2016. In its fiscal year 2017 IRS Form 990 filing, Sustainable Opportunity Development Center, a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 18 employ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$64,000. The highest compensated employee at Sustainable Opportunity Development Center is Mike Mancuso with fiscal year 2017 compensation of $64,000.

THE MISSION OF THE CENTER FOR SUSTAINABLE OPPORTUNITY DEVELOPMENT IS TO:CREATE AN ENTREPRENEURIAL ENVIRONMENT IN SALEM AND THE SURROUNDING AREA RICH WITH OPPORTUNITY FOR INDIVIDUALS AND INDUSTRY;CONNECT THE COMMUNITY TO REGIONAL ECONOMIC AND ENTERPRISE DEVELOPMENT RESOURCES THAT CAN BENEFIT LOCAL INDUSTRY AND ENTREPRENEURS, AND;COMPETE ON A STATE-WIDE AND NATIONAL LEVEL WITH AN ECONOMIC AND ENTREPRENEURIAL ENVIRONMENT RECOGNIZED FOR DRAMATICALLY ENHANCING LOCAL WEALTH CREATION, EMPLOYMENT AND QUALITY OF LIFE.
